Watcher Wednesday: Spider-Men Update

Happy Wednesday, everyone! It’s time for a Spider-Men update. As most of you know, I’m a devoted fan of Spider-Man and when I heard that there was going to be a crossover between the normal Earth-616 Peter Parker and the Ultimate universe’s Miles Morales, I jumped in the air. This was the first time that the two universes coincide and people were excited because the comic book writers specifically said that they would never cross over the two worlds.

The 50th anniversary of Spider-Man sure changed that decision. Mind you, comic book decisions never really stay…decided (“No one in comics stays dead except Uncle Ben”). Since I’ve talked about the history of this decision last time, I thought I should give you all an update on this limited series.

So far, we’ve discovered that the conniving Mysterio was responsible for sending Peter Parker to the Ultimate universe, where the first person he bumps into is our very own Miles Morales. As is common in comic book team-up stories, a misunderstanding ensues and they both battle it out before settling on a truce. Nick Fury (the Ultimate Samuel L. Jackson version) informs Peter of his situation and like every person accidentally transported to an alternate dimension where things are slightly different, his reaction isn’t too spectacular.

So Peter and Miles get to know each other while they’re sent on a mission when their helicopter explodes and they find themselves at the mercy of Mysterio. They work together and manage to defeat him, but in the ensuing chaos, Peter darts away to find himself at the house of Aunt May and Gwen Stacy, both still grieving the death of the Ultimate Peter Parker…
